Google woos SMEs with push for Workspace platform

Google is aiming to inspire small businesses and entrepreneurs to embrace its productivity and collaboration platform, Google Workspace, by showcasing how it is helping SMEs across Britain grow.

The “10 Stories” campaign is part of Google’s wider commitment to the UK economy and its ambition to equip the nation with essential digital skills.

Aimed at entrepreneurs, business decision-makers and small-medium business owners, the eight-week drive seeks to increase awareness of Google Workspace and showcase its role in unlocking productivity and creativity through AI.

At the heart of the campaign are a series of ten documentary-style films capturing the stories of Google Workspace customers from across the UK.

Each of the businesses featured share how Google Workspace with Gemini helps them fly through daily admin, freeing them up to focus on what really matters: growing their business.

Those taking part include business leaders from clothing brand Peregrine (pictured), brush specialist Kent Brushes and confectioner Roly’s Fudge discussing how they are using Google Workspace with Gemini to support daily admin and free up time.

The creative execution includes over 300 assets, across formats including video on demand, digital, national press, out of home, social media, and podcasts.

This includes Google’s AI Works for Business events, featuring media placements across sites including the second-largest digital billboard in Europe, which delivers an estimated 1.2 million impressions every 2 weeks. The ads are also appearing on the UK’s biggest indoor advertising screen, Waterloo Motion.

Google Cloud UK marketing director Barnaby Voss said: “We built this campaign around authentic stories to celebrate the creativity and ambition of real people using Google Workspace with Gemini to turn big ideas into reality.”
